KENTUCKY
Share of Federal and State Funds Used by Category

Basic Assistance 38% Pie Chart showing TANF KY funds use
Child Care Spent or Transferred 17%
Transferred to SSBG 6%
Transportation and Supportive Services 6%
Education and Training 4%
Other Work Activities/Expenses 15%
Administration and Systems 9%
Other Nonassistance 4%
Remaining Categories 1%

Remaining Categories: Less than 3% each used for Pregancy Prevention and Two Parent Formation.
No funds used for Authorized Under Prior Law, Individual Development Accounts, Refundable Tax Credits, or Nonrecurrent Short Term Benefits.
Categories not included due to negative numbers: Work Subsidies.

Notes:  CCDF = Child Care Development Fund; SSBG = Social Services Block Grant; EITC = Earned Income Tax Credit
